Here's the fine print:
https://pages.ebay.com/promo/2018/1112/71510.html
What is the Promotion?
This Coupon is a 25% discount, valid from 8:00 AM PT on November 12, 2018 until 11:59 PM PT on November 13, 2018. No minimum purchase required. Discount applies to the purchase price (excluding shipping, handling, and taxes) of eligible item(s) on ebay.com. Eligible items are items with a 25% discount coupon available through the offer code PAYWCARD displayed at checkout. The discount will be applied to eligible item(s) only and will be capped at a value of $25. Eligible items exclude warranties and protection plans.

Hi @bigdeals.etc, this coupon was not marketed on our site and did not have a public facing page advertising it. Instead it appears during checkout with eligible items.
We intended the code to only appear on specific items during checkout to help ensure buyers only saw it when purchasing eligible items. Unfortunately, some 3rd party 'deals' sites began advertising the discount code. Many buyers obtained the code from these 3rd party sites, which created confusion amongst when they attempt to use the code on non-eligible items.
